How do you cite a book in the Optical Nanoscopy referencing style? (2024 Guide)
Did you know there are over 2.5 million book titles published in 2021. If you find yourself trying to cite a book in Optical Nanoscopy, here’s howHere’s an example book citation in Optical Nanoscopy using placeholders:
Last Name FN (2000) Title, Edition. Publisher, City
Optical Nanoscopy citation:
Angelou M (1969) I Know Why the Caged Bird Sings, 1st edn.. Random House, New York

How to reference a journal article in the Optical Nanoscopy citation style?
How do you cite scientific papers in Optical Nanoscopy format?
The basic information included in your citation will be the same across all styles. However, the format in which that information is presented is somewhat different depending on style you need. To cite a paper in Optical Nanoscopy, follow this exampleHere’s a Optical Nanoscopy journal citation example using placeholders:
Author1 LastnameAF, Author3 LastnameAF (2000) Title. Container Volume:pages Used. https://doi.org/DOI
Petit C, Sieffermann J (2007) Testing consumer preferences for iced-coffee: Does the drinking environment have any influence?. 18:161-172. https://doi.org/10.1016/j.foodqual.2006.05.008

How to cite a website in a paper in Optical Nanoscopy style?
Citing your sources is a necessary part of any research paper. To cite a website in Optical Nanoscopy this is what you needHere’s an Optical Nanoscopy example website reference:
Author1 LastnameAF, Author2 LastnameAF (2000) Title. https://www.example.com. Accessed 23 Apr. 2024
https://www.theguardian.com/world/2008/nov/05/uselections20083
on The Guardian website:
Tran M (2008) Barack Obama To Be America’s First Black President. https://www.theguardian.com/world/2008/nov/05/uselections20083. Accessed 23 Apr. 2024

How to cite a YouTube video Optical Nanoscopy in 2024
Are you watching a YouTube video and you don’t know how to cite it? Here’s a simple way to do it in Optical NanoscopyHere’s a Optical Nanoscopy citation YouTube video example:
ChannelName (2000) Title. In: YouTube.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=XXXXXX. Accessed 23 Apr. 2024
Pixar (2015) Pizza Clip — Inside Out. In: YouTube.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=8W6rntBADUQ. Accessed 23 Apr. 2024
